With £40m price tags for us at the moment as a newly promoted team and league status not being stable for at least this year and next, my first instinct is just to baulk at it and feel like it's too much almost regardless of the player. When I think about it more though, the example I come back to is Morgan Gibbs-White, who Forest paid up to £42m for as a newly promoted team. At the time that seemed crazy for Forest, for MGW and for a newly promoted team in general but looking back, they would surely say it was completely worth it now?

I think that's where I'm at. If you're signing a player who you strongly believe can do for us what MGW did for Forest in terms of keeping them in the league in those first two seasons, then I think you have to just pull the trigger and not let the worry of a £40m package versus, say, £25-30m be the reason to turn down someone who will be a difference maker to that extent.

All that being said, I wouldn't be at all surprised if ultimately a £5m 'loan fee' and a £30m obligation in summer or thereabouts got it done.

The caps were in the African Nations Championship which is like AFCON but squads have to be selected purely from players playing in each country's domestic league so it's quite different to being called up for Nigeria for most games.
